Hybrid Senior System Software Test Engineer, Networking

Posted 2 months ago

Apply now

About the role

  • Software Test Engineer in NVIDIA's team, handling verification and testing of NVIDIA-Cumulus Linux features. Collaborating with teams and customers to ensure quality in high-performance computing environments.

Responsibilities

  • Internally replicating customer deployments and conducting customer-focused testing
  • Reproducing customer-found defects
  • Collaborating with field teams and development to quickly resolve customer issues from the engineering side
  • Engaging with customers to assist with deployments and upgrades
  • Driving post-escalation RCA to identify patterns and areas for improvement
  • Functional Testing of various Layer2 and Layer3 features of NVIDIA-Mellanox Spectrum series Ethernet Switch systems running NVIDIA-Cumulus Linux
  • Writing detailed feature and system test plans, and define and design test beds and topologies
  • Reporting issues found during testing into the defect tracking system and validate the fixes and workarounds
  • Developing automated test suites for different features of NVIDIA-Cumulus Linux
  • Building and maintaining automation required to ensure quality via continuous functional regression
  • Collaborating with design, test and other internal engineering groups to identify, report, and resolve issues found during testing

Requirements

  • B.S degree or equivalent experience in Engineering/Computer Science/related field
  • 5+ years of proven experience in Software Quality Engineering; with 3+ years of shown experience in handling escalations
  • Strong technical abilities, problem-solving, design, coding, and debugging skills
  • Hands-on experience on any Layer2 and Layer3 protocol like MLAG, VLAN, STP, OSPF, BGP, EVPN, etc.
  • Experience in using test tools like Ixia or Spirent, and working experience with test management tools
  • Strong skills in Python or other scripting languages are essential
  • Good experience working on Unix or Linux-based OS
  • Multi-tasking abilities and good interpersonal skills
  • Proven understanding of software engineering practices

Benefits

  • Competitive salaries
  • Generous benefits package

Job title

Senior System Software Test Engineer, Networking

Job type

Experience level

Senior

Salary

$148,000 - $287,500 per year

Degree requirement

Bachelor's Degree

Tech skills

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job